About this event
Julia Beerhold‘s documentary tells the story of her own family: during the post-war economic miracle, her parents beat and humiliated her and her brother while simultaneously claiming to love them. As an adult, Beerhold returns to her childhood home, breaks the silence with her mother, and confronts the violence that happened behind closed doors. The 79-minute film moves between past and present, examining guilt, forgiveness, and the longing to break free from destructive patterns. The screening is followed by a talk with Tanja Dietz (Goethe University Frankfurt, childhood and family research) and Anna Sica-Ott (Kinderschutzbund Frankfurt, counselling for victims of childhood violence), hosted by Christina Budde. This is a quiet, serious evening that goes deeper than a typical movie night – it’s for people who want to understand how family trauma and post-war upbringing still shape lives today.
